### **Anti Fingerprint Coatings Type Insights**

The Anti Fingerprint Coatings Market segmentation, based on type, includes hydrophobic coating and oleophobic coating. The oleophobic coating segment accounted for the largest market share in 2022. Oleophobic coating prevents fingerprints from smudging smartphones or other devices' displays while also repelling grease. This kind of coating makes glass more resistant to scratches since lower friction will cause harmful objects to slip off the surface rather than scratch it. The oleophobic coating does, however, wear off over time, which reduces the pace of adoption.

### **Anti-Fingerprint Coatings Technology Insights**

The Anti Fingerprint Coatings Market segmentation, based on technology, includes vacuum deposition, [sol gel](../../../reports/sol-gel-product-market-38181), and others. The vacuum deposition segment accounted for largest market share in 2022. Anti-fingerprint coating is produced with the help of technology. The manufacture of these coatings has expanded as a result of various technological developments. One of the main areas of use for global anti-fingerprint coating is vacuum deposition. A thin layer of coating is applied to the surface of various items using the vacuum deposition technique, which is employed by a number of end-user industries, including the automotive, consumer goods, and building and construction.

Technology: Vacuum Deposition (Dominant) vs. Sol Gel (Emerging)

Vacuum Deposition technology stands as the dominant choice in the Anti Fingerprint Coatings Market, known for its ability to produce high-quality and resilient coatings. It utilizes a physical vapor deposition process that ensures uniformity and adhesion, making it ideal for high-performance applications across electronics and consumer products. Conversely, Sol Gel technology is emerging as a compelling alternative for many manufacturers, offering a more accessible and flexible approach to coating applications. The Sol Gel process is relatively simpler and allows for customization, leading to significant interest from firms aiming for innovation and budget-friendly solutions. While Vacuum Deposition remains the preferred choice, Sol Gel's rising demand indicates a shift in market focus toward versatility and cost-effectiveness.
